Andersen unifies its Latin America platform
The Latin American member firms of Andersen Global will now operate under the brand ‘Andersen’
The member firms of Andersen Global in Brazil, Ecuador, Guatemala, Mexico and Uruguay, which previously operated under the brands ‘Andersen Tax’ and ‘Andersen Tax & Legal’, will now carry the Andersen brand along with the new member firms, MODO Law and GSRC in Argentina, which became member firms of the organisation earlier this year.
The change follows the adoption of the Andersen brand by the firm’s European member firms.
The unification of all the firms in the region under the same banner reinforces the organisation’s position as a one-stop shop for tax and legal services globally, Andersen said in a statement.
“Andersen Global continues to view expansion of both its footprint in Latin America and its newly established platform in the Caribbean as high priorities,” the firm said.
In Latin America, Andersen also has a presence in Chile, Colombia, Costa Rica, El Salvador, Honduras, Nicaragua, Panama, Paraguay and Peru, through its collaborating firms, and has added collaborating firms in 11 countries in the Caribbean region over the last six months.
Earlier this month, Andersen entered the Chilean market through collaboration agreements with two Santiago-based firms, Chirgwin Peñafiel and tax firm SPASA Consulting. And in May, Andersen expanded its presence in Mexico through a collaboration agreement with local tax firm SKATT.

Andersen Global debuted in Latin America in 2015 and now has a presence in more than 34 locations in the region, with 1,000 tax and legal professionals, and 90 partners.
